Step-by-Step Guide to Connecting Samsung Level U Wireless Headphones
Now let’s walk through the process of connecting your Samsung Level U headphones to a Bluetooth-compatible device.
Step 1: Power On Your Headphones
To start, you need to turn on your Samsung Level U headphones. Locate the Power Button, which is typically situated on the neckband. Press and hold this button until you hear a tone, and the LED indicator lights up in blue.
Step 2: Enable Pairing Mode
Once the headphones are powered on, you must put them into pairing mode. Press and hold the Volume Up and Power buttons together until you hear “Bluetooth pairing,” and the LED lights start blinking alternately in blue and red. This indicates that your headphones are discoverable.
Step 3: Access Bluetooth Settings on Your Device
Next, go to your device’s settings:
- For Android devices: Open the **Settings** app, select **Connections**, and then tap on **Bluetooth**. Make sure Bluetooth is turned on.
- For iOS devices: Open the **Settings** app, tap on **Bluetooth**, and ensure that it is enabled.
- For Windows computers: Click on the **Start Menu**, select **Settings**, then **Devices**, and click on **Bluetooth & other devices**. Turn on Bluetooth if it is off.
Step 4: Search for Devices
In the Bluetooth settings menu on your device, it will automatically search for available devices within range. Allow a few moments for your Samsung Level U headphones to appear in the list of discoverable devices.
Step 5: Connect Your Headphones
Once you see “Level U” listed, tap on it. Your device may prompt you to confirm the connection; if so, select Pair. After a successful pairing, you’ll often hear a confirmation sound, indicating the headphones are connected.
Step 6: Check Connectivity
To ensure everything is working correctly, play some audio on your device. Check the audio quality and make sure you can hear clearly through your headphones. Adjust the volume using either the device or headphone control options.
Troubleshooting Connection Issues
Even with a straightforward process, you may occasionally encounter connection issues. Here are some common problems and their solutions:
Headphones Not Detected
If your Samsung Level U headphones don’t appear in the list of available devices:
- Make sure the headphones are powered on and in pairing mode.
- Check if another device is currently connected to the headphones. If so, disconnect them from the other device.
Connection Failed
If the connection fails or if you experience persistent issues:
- Turn off both the headphones and the device, then try the pairing process again.
- Reset the headphones to factory settings. This can typically be done by holding down the volume down button and power button simultaneously until you hear a tone.
Audio Quality Problems
In case of poor audio quality:
- Ensure you are within an appropriate distance from the audio device.
- Check the battery level of your headphones; low battery can affect performance.

How do I charge my Samsung Level U Wireless Headphones?
Charging your Samsung Level U Wireless Headphones is a straightforward process. First, locate the micro USB charging port on the headphones. Use the included USB cable to connect the headphones to a power source, such as a wall adapter, computer, or power bank. Once connected, the indicator light will illuminate to show that the headphones are charging.
For optimal performance, it is recommended to charge the headphones fully before first use. Typically, a full charge takes around 2 hours and will provide several hours of playback time. Always ensure that you use the proper charging equipment to avoid damaging the battery.

How do I clean my Samsung Level U Wireless Headphones?
To clean your Samsung Level U Wireless Headphones, start by disconnecting them from any devices and turning them off. Use a soft, dry cloth to wipe the exterior surfaces of the headphones, removing any dirt or sweat build-up. For the ear tips, gently remove them and clean with warm, soapy water. Be sure to let them dry completely before reattaching them to the headphones.
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that could damage the headphone finish.
